Can you go into ketosis without eating carbs?

It typically takes 2–4 days to enter ketosis if you eat fewer than 50 grams of carbs per day. However, some people may take longer depending on factors like physical activity level, age, metabolism, and carb, fat, and protein intake.

Can you take exogenous ketones while fasting?

Clinical data suggest that taking supplemental ketones during fasting increases blood levels of ketones but decreases levels of free fatty acids, indicating that the body is no longer relying on stored fatty acids. Although exogenous ketones provide a ready source of energy, their use might interfere with weight loss.

Why can’t I get into ketosis again?

The most common reason for not getting into ketosis is not cutting back enough on carbs. According to a 2019 article on the ketogenic diet, carbohydrates should represent only 5–10\% of a person’s calorie intake. Specifically, most keto diets require a person to cut down to between 20 and 50 grams of carbs each day.

Do exogenous ketones stop fat burning?

Ketones Inhibit Fat Breakdown In other words, the higher your blood ketone levels are, the less your body produces. As a result, taking ketone supplements may prevent body fat from being used as fuel, at least in the short term ( 19 , 20 ).

Can drinking keto drinks induce ketosis?

Researchers asked 15 healthy participants to consume drinks that contained either ketone esters or ketone salts. Both types of EK induced a state of ketosis in the participants. However, this study involved only a small number of people. Further research is necessary to establish the accuracy of the findings.

Do exogenous ketone supplements increase appetite?

Taking exogenous ketone supplements increase ketone levels in your body, imitating the state of ketosis achieved through a ketogenic diet. Ketone supplements have been shown to decrease appetite, which may help you lose weight by eating less. ). ). However, ketone supplements may not affect appetite as much in people who have had a meal beforehand.
